GNDU Series

Designed for Precision Platform Rotation Special output structure for rotating disk (flange) rigidity. Attach load directly onto disk for rotating, save space and simplify mechanism. Has crossed roller bearing for rigid rotation, precise positioning and high axial and radial force capability. Lubricated for life.: Feature Flange-style Output Face. Output housing is aluminum. Suitable for combination with any kind of motors.
